Output 582b5aac6306fdaedb7c9d4d79239b7663520d9d255e8bf0c46c61850082269e:2

value
15575130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9694ca78f3a9ccaa43c28b245418b4bd569b2808 OP_EQUAL
address
3FRDXVUqZy21iXSA6FFSHrG5Z8FkVwMp3A
transaction
582b5aac6306fdaedb7c9d4d79239b7663520d9d255e8bf0c46c61850082269e
spent
true